Aranwen


Gender: Feminine
Language
: Welsh
Etymology:
Aranwen is a Welsh name meaning “Silver White” from “aran” (silver) and “gwen” (white, holy, fair).

History:
Aranwen is a name from Welsh legend, said to belong to a daughter of the 5th century King Brychan. It was first used as a real name in the 20th century.

Pronunciation: a-ree-an-wen.

Alternates: Arianwen.
